Celebrate Black History & Culture at the Library

Join us for a special lineup of programs and events throughout February in celebration of Black History Month! This year marks a milestone: 100 years since our nation first began officially commemorating Black history, culture and achievements.

From interactive celebrations to hands-on arts and crafts, classic film screenings and more, explore experiences that highlight the history, rich culture and lasting contributions of African Americans across our nation.

Who Am I? Video Series

Who Am I? - Oscar Micheaux
Who was Oscar Micheaux? He was a homesteader, an author, the first major African American feature filmmaker and more.

Who Am I? - Zora Neale Hurston
Who was Zora Neale Hurston? She was Barnard College’s first Black graduate, an author of the Harlem renaissance and more.

Who Am I? - Madam C.J. Walker
Who was Madam C.J. Walker? She was an entrepreneur, the first female self-made millionaire and more.

Who Am I? - Bessie Smith
Who was Bessie Smith? She was a roller-skating champion, singer and songwriter, Empress of the Blues and more.
